.sp-bar{font-family:var(--font-mono);flex-direction:column;gap:4px;font-size:12px;display:flex}.sp-bar.compact{gap:2px;font-size:11px}.sp-stat{align-items:center;gap:8px;display:flex}.sp-label{text-align:right;flex-shrink:0;width:28px;font-weight:600}.sp-track{background:var(--bg-input);border-radius:3px;flex:1;height:6px;overflow:hidden}.compact .sp-track{height:4px}.sp-fill{border-radius:3px;height:100%;transition:width .2s}.sp-value{text-align:right;width:20px;color:var(--text-secondary);flex-shrink:0}.sp-total{text-align:right;color:var(--text-muted);margin-top:2px;font-size:11px}.sp-total span{color:var(--text-secondary);font-weight:600}.sp-total.over span{color:var(--accent-rose)}
